MAORI MISSION CONVENTION

Labour Week-eud Function A Maori mission convention. the first of its kind ever organised by the Anglican Church in the South Island will be conducted at Tuahiwi Pa during Labour weekend. To be addressed by Maori and pakeha Anglican church ; leaders from both islands, I the convention will be atten- | ded by about 200 io 300 Maoris from Maori communi- . ties throughout Canterbury land Westland. | Lectures, discussions and i other activities would aim to "deepen the spiritual life of the Maori people” and to bring an awareness of the place of religion in their lives, said a spokesman for the convention’s organising committee yesterday.
